Output d6ba1ab1b31b0243986ac560bef0e45e3145a77ab06f19e4d72ae77d76972cb1:0

value
3406838344
script pubkey
OP_0 OP_PUSHBYTES_20 70aea3fb41961feb7ca7a6a2e0ab74e3c807d162
address
tb1qwzh2876pjc07kl98563wp2m5u0yq05tz5ft5xn
transaction
d6ba1ab1b31b0243986ac560bef0e45e3145a77ab06f19e4d72ae77d76972cb1